Amasai

1. Son of Elkanah, a Levite of the Kohathite family (1 Chronicles 6:10,20; 2 Chronicles 29:12). 2. Chief of the captains who met David at Ziklag and offered their services to him. It is possible that he is identical with AMASA (1 Chronicles 12:19). 3. One of the priests who blew trumpets when David brought back the Ark of the Covenant (1 Chronicles 15:24).
